Yesterday we had to say good bye to one of our foundation mares and cornerstone of the farm Luna. Luna was a fantastic mom with a larger then life personality. She was a Verband States Premium mare which is the highest placing she can reach and originally was bred in Germany then imported to the United States while pregnant with her first baby. One of the judges commented on her during her daughters foal inspection and stated that the only thing wrong with her was that she was no longer in Germany.
She passed on her beauty and amazing technique to her offspring. She was also sure to pass on her love and self confidence to her children. From the covergirl of the GOV Oldenburg magazine when Ashanti stopped to smell the floors to multiple championships in the ring, her children show her fantastic type and mothering.
